Beispiel #1
0
 public BulkUploadScheduleEventCsvJobData(JToken node) : base(node)
 {
     if (node["csvVersion"] != null)
     {
         this._CsvVersion = (BulkUploadCsvVersion)ParseEnum(typeof(BulkUploadCsvVersion), node["csvVersion"].Value <string>());
     }
     if (node["columns"] != null)
     {
         this._Columns = new List <String>();
         foreach (var arrayNode in node["columns"].Children())
         {
             this._Columns.Add(ObjectFactory.Create <String>(arrayNode));
         }
     }
 }
        public BulkUploadCsvJobData(XmlElement node) : base(node)
        {
            foreach (XmlElement propertyNode in node.ChildNodes)
            {
                switch (propertyNode.Name)
                {
                case "csvVersion":
                    this._CsvVersion = (BulkUploadCsvVersion)ParseEnum(typeof(BulkUploadCsvVersion), propertyNode.InnerText);
                    continue;

                case "columns":
                    this._Columns = new List <String>();
                    foreach (XmlElement arrayNode in propertyNode.ChildNodes)
                    {
                        this._Columns.Add(ObjectFactory.Create <String>(arrayNode));
                    }
                    continue;
                }
            }
        }